Game Summary
The Chicago Cubs will face off against the Kansas City Royals at Kauffman Stadium in Kansas City, Missouri, on July 28th. This matchup sees two teams with contrasting seasons so far. The Cubs are currently holding a 57-48 record, ranking them 7th in wins and their recent form has been a bit of a rollercoaster. The Royals, on the other hand, have struggled this season with a 50-56 record, placing them towards the lower end of the standings.
Historically, the Cubs have had a slight edge over the Royals in their recent matchups. The Cubs' offense, led by players like Christopher Morel and Ian Happ, has been a key factor in their successes. Meanwhile, the Royals have relied heavily on the likes of Bobby Witt Jr. and Salvador Perez to carry their offense.
The probable pitchers for this game are Javier Assad for the Cubs and Cole Ragans for the Royals. Assad has a 4-3 record with a 3.15 ERA, while Ragans boasts a 7-6 record with a 3.23 ERA. Both pitchers have shown solid form and will be looking to stifle the opposing offenses.
Recent performances indicate that this game could be a closely contested one, with both teams having moments of brilliance and lapses in form. The Cubs' recent games include a mix of wins and losses, while the Royals have also experienced a similar patch of inconsistencies.

Player Analysis
Ian Happ has been a key player for the Chicago Cubs this season. Batting primarily in the middle of the lineup, Happ has accumulated a .271 batting average, coupled with 18 home runs and 60 RBIs. His ability to hit for power and average makes him a constant threat to opposing pitchers.
Happ's recent form has been impressive, contributing significantly to the Cubs' offense. He has a knack for stepping up in crucial moments, and his stats back that up. With a slugging percentage of .471 and an on-base percentage of .348, Happ has shown that he can get on base and drive in runs consistently.
Opposing Analysis
Facing Happ will be Cole Ragans, who has had a solid season for the Royals. With a 7-6 record and a 3.23 ERA, Ragans has been one of the more reliable pitchers for Kansas City. However, the Cubs' lineup, which includes power hitters like Happ, could pose a significant challenge.
The Royals' pitching staff has been somewhat inconsistent this season. While Ragans has been a standout, the bullpen has had its struggles, ranking 22nd in saves. This could play into the Cubs' hands if they can work Ragans out of the game early and get to the bullpen.

Team Previews
Chicago Cubs
The Cubs' offense has been one of their strengths this season, ranking 10th in batting average (.251) and tied for 10th in runs scored (483). Players like Ian Happ and Christopher Morel have been key contributors. The pitching staff has also been solid, with a team ERA of 3.72, ranking 7th in the league.
Defensively, the Cubs have committed 49 errors, ranking 23rd, which is an area they need to improve. Their bullpen, with 24 saves, has been reliable in close games.
Kansas City Royals
The Royals have struggled offensively, ranking 24th in hits (809) and runs (424). Bobby Witt Jr. and Salvador Perez have been the standout performers, but the rest of the lineup has been inconsistent.
Pitching has been a mixed bag for the Royals. While their starters, including Cole Ragans, have shown promise, the bullpen has been less reliable. The Royals' team ERA of 3.73 ranks 8th, indicating that their pitchers have been able to keep them in games.
